The Steel Structure Automatic Painting Line by Yeed Tech Co., Ltd. represents a significant advancement in the automation of steel component painting. This fully automated system addresses the inefficiencies and inconsistencies of manual painting processes, offering a solution that enhances productivity, reduces labor costs, and ensures uniform coating quality. Designed for large-scale steel structures, this system integrates cutting-edge technologies such as 3D scanning, intelligent spraying, and catalytic infrared drying to deliver superior results.
The system employs a chain T-shaped support design, ensuring uniform spacing between support points and coinciding contact points. This design allows for an unobstructed spraying process, minimizing the need for subsequent paint repair work. The one-click automatic operation and intelligent adjustment of travel distance between batches significantly reduce spraying intervals, boosting overall efficiency.
Equipped with a comprehensive scanning system, the line automatically identifies the three-dimensional structure of steel components. This enables the recognition of shape patterns and intelligent stopping of spraying on placement gaps, bolts, and brackets. The automatic paint dispenser ensures precise application, reducing waste and improving coverage.
The drying system utilizes a French Sunkiss Matherm infrared heating plate. By mixing natural gas with air in a specific ratio, the system achieves flameless combustion on a catalyst surface, avoiding energy loss from visible light. This results in high efficiency, energy savings, environmental protection, and durability.
The longitudinal conveying device ensures smooth transportation of steel components through the painting process. Its intelligent design allows for automatic scanning of component structures, preparing them for precise spraying. The system's two sets of spray guns, each with six nozzles, are programmed based on scanning results to optimize spray coverage and reduce costs.
| Parameter | Details |
|---|---|
| Painting Method | Automatic spray painting with 3D scanning |
| Spray Gun Configuration | Two sets of spray guns with six nozzles each |
| Drying System | Natural gas catalytic infrared radiation |
| Load Capacity | 3.5T per scissor lift |
| Transportation Speed | Adjustable based on spraying speed |
| Automation Level | Full automation with intelligent adjustment |
| Energy Efficiency | High efficiency with low energy consumption |
